Output 0ea8c05f81edd34c3d7c10903a9bfe59ab264f59ed5533ccba983833d07fe6d1:0

value
1734358424
script pubkey
OP_0 OP_PUSHBYTES_20 ab980a2b265e1b7ef5eecf59f3a41d66437985b0
address
tb1q4wvq52extcdhaa0weavl8fqavephnpdsx34n0r
transaction
0ea8c05f81edd34c3d7c10903a9bfe59ab264f59ed5533ccba983833d07fe6d1
confirmations
105770
spent
true